Dear friends in Christ, 🌟 As we journey through the sacred pages of Scripture, let's pause and reflect on these powerful words from Joshua 10:8: 'Do not fear them, for I have given them into your hands; not one of them shall stand before you.' Spoken by the Lord to Joshua as he faced the formidable kings of the Amorites, this verse is a divine assurance of victory and protection. In the heat of battle, amidst overwhelming odds, God reminds His faithful servant—and us—that fear has no place when He is our shield.
Drawing from the wisdom of the Early Church Fathers, St. Augustine beautifully reflects on such passages in his writings, emphasizing how God's promises conquer our fears. He teaches us that true courage springs not from our own strength, but from trusting in the Almighty who has already secured the triumph. Just as Joshua led the Israelites with unwavering faith, Augustine urges us to cast aside anxiety, for 'God is faithful, and He will not let you be tempted beyond your ability' (1 Corinthians 10:13). This timeless insight invites us to see our own 'battles' through the lens of divine providence.
